Boeing 737/500 9H-YES(AXY 2807) being vectored to ILS for 32(1650), parking on Multiflight/East. Believed aircraft in staying overnight to operate charter outbound in morning

This aircraft was once operated by British Midland as G-BVZI
I would think this could be our new local big league team, Huddersfield Town, who are due to go out to Austria. Nothing is showing on the LBA departures boards.
 
Eurocopter EC-120B PH-LPH arrived at 1620 after negotiating some bad weather south of the airfield.
Parked on Multiflight/East for refuel.
 
Lear Jet 45 LX-EAA(Lion King 8 Ambulance) being vectored onto ILS, 32(1320) immerdiatley followed by Ryanair company hack Lear Jet 45 M-ABJA. 'JA had overshot from his first approach due to being too high.
 
Global Express CS-GLD(Fraction 770N) being vectored onto ILS, runway 32(1335).
Overshot from approach due windshear gain of 10 - 15 knots and holding over LBA at 5000'.
Following the arrival of King Air, A.319, A320 and 2x757's all reporting it being "bumpy" he is making another approach.
Landed 1415.

An interesting aircraft about to fly directly over the airport heading Northwest is US Navy C-2A Greyhound 162168 callsign RG-01 at 18000. Can clearly hear it in Horsforth but is hidden by cloud.

US Air Force U-28A 07-0821(Highly modified Pilatus PC-12) also currently South of Sheffield heading North, will pass just to West of LBA.
